In 2024, Private Equity Holding's total liabilities amounted to 54.81 M EUR, a 48.41% difference from the 36.93 M EUR total liabilities in the previous year.

What does Private Equity Holding do?

The Private Equity Holding AG is a Swiss holding company specializing in investing in private equity funds. The company was founded in 1996 and is headquartered in Zug, Switzerland. The business model of the Private Equity Holding AG consists of investing as a capital provider in private equity funds. Private equity funds are typically closed funds that raise capital from institutional investors and high net worth individuals. These funds then invest the capital in privately held companies and actively participate in their business development. Private Equity Holding AG is active in various sectors, including buyouts, expansion capital, and mezzanine. Buyouts focuses on acquiring companies, usually through a private equity fund, and then selling or taking them public. Expansion capital invests in companies that are still in the growth phase to support further growth. Mezzanine financing deals with the financing of companies in the transition between debt and equity. The products offered by Private Equity Holding AG mainly include investments in various private equity funds that invest in different regions and industries. The company aims for a broad diversification of its funds to spread the risk and achieve higher returns. Private Equity Holding AG has a portfolio of over 200 funds investing in North America, Europe, and Asia. Stock savings plans offer an attractive way for investors to build wealth over the long term. One of the main advantages is the so-called cost-average effect: by regularly investing a fixed amount in stocks or stock funds, you automatically buy more shares when prices are low, and fewer when they are high. This can lead to a more favorable average price per share over time. In addition, stock savings plans allow small investors access to expensive stocks, as they can participate with small amounts. Regular investment also promotes a disciplined investment strategy and helps to avoid emotional decisions, such as impulsive buying or selling. Furthermore, investors benefit from the potential appreciation of the stocks as well as from dividend distributions, which can be reinvested, enhancing the compounding effect and thus the growth of the invested capital.
